LEFT/ RIGHT/ MENU/ OK button

LEFT / RIGHT/ MENU/ OK buttons activate the following.

- LEFT button

: While the menu is showing, press the LEFT button to select the menu

 

tab to the left of the cursor.

- RIGHT button

: While the menu is showing, press the RIGHT button to select the menu

 

tab to the right of the cursor, or to move an secondary menu.

- MENU button

: When you press the MENU button, the play mode menu will be

 

displayed on the LCD monitor. Pressing it again will return the LCD to

 

the initial display.

- OK button

: When the menu is displayed on the LCD monitor, the OK button is used

 

for confirming data that is changed by using the 5 function button.

LCD ( ) button

The shooting information will be displayed on the LCD monitor.

The last image stored in the memory is displayed on the LCD monitor by pressing the play mode button.

Pressing the LCD( ) button in the PLAY mode will change the display as shown below. [Image & Icons] → [Image & Information] → [Image only]
